Chouhan justifies RSS decision
Jabalpur, Sep 15 (UNI) Madhya Pradesh Chief Minister Shivraj Singh Chouhan today justified the decision to lift a ban on government officials from taking part in RSS activities.
''The RSS is a cultural organisation involved in nation building and has inspired several lakh workers in doing service for the country. Taking this into consideration, the government has lifted the ban on its officials imposed by the previous Congress regime,'' Mr Chouhan told reporters at the airport here.
He denied any cabinet expansion in near future and said appointments to the boards were being made as per requirement.
The Chief Minister described Madhya Pradesh being declared 'fastest moving state' at the India Today Conclave as a rare honour for the state, which was struggling to come out of 'Bimaru' tag until recent past.
Mr Chouhan said he had learnt from media about the Governor seeking some information regarding the Freedom of Religion (Amendment) Act. However, he had no information in this regard.
He said he regularly met the Governor and any information sought by him would be provided.
